VU6005649 Usage And Synthesis

Uses

VU 6005649, is a novel mGlu7/8 receptor agonist with excellent CNS penetration (Kp 1.9-5.8 and Kp,uu 0.4-1.4).

in vivo

When VU6005649 (compound 9f) is dosed at 30 mg/kg IP in 10% Tween 80/H2O (0.75 mg/kg. s.c. amphetamine), no efficacy is observed in this assay. VU6005649 shows modest but significant pro-cognitive effects on associative learning in wild-type mice and the first example of efficacy of an mGlu7/8 positive allosteric modulator (PAM) in this model[1].

IC 50

mGlu7 Receptor: 0.65 μM (EC50); mGlu8 Receptor: 2.6 μM (EC50)
